PAPER CONTAINER
20210347521 · 2021-11-11 ·

A paper container having a top portion (4) that is tightly closed by bonding together opposing surfaces of first top sealing panels (20) and opposing surfaces of second top sealing panels (22), and each of side panels (16) is folded along a first side panel folding line (26) and a second side panel folding line (27) to form a flap (35) having a substantially triangular shape. The top portion (4) is formed by folding down the flaps (35) onto right and left side surfaces of a tubular body (3) through mountain-folding along front-side top panel vertical folding lines (17), front-side top panel vertical folding lines (18), and front-side top sealing vertical folding lines (23), and through valley-folding along second top portion horizontal folding lines (15) and back-side top sealing vertical folding lines (24).

APPARATUS TO HOUSE BOTANICALS DURING TRANSPORT

An apparatus for housing botanicals during transport is disclosed. The apparatus may be configured to convert to a display assembly for the botanicals. The apparatus may include: a covering component having a primary opening on one end and a permeable structure on a second end; a sleeve component having a support structure on one end and a receiving opening on a second end, the sleeve component being configured to be partially inserted into the covering component; a holding component having a secondary opening at one end and a water-tight chamber wall at the other end, the holding component being configured to be partially inserted into the sleeve component, such that the secondary opening is positioned within the sleeve component; in order facilitate converting the apparatus into a display assembly, the covering component is removed from the sleeve component and the holding component is inserted into the covering component.

Square liquids retaining bowl-type folded container
11814220 · 2023-11-14 ·

A liquid retaining folded laminar container made from a cold or heat pre-cut paper or plastic sheet. The laminar container comprises engraved lines that enable folding to form a container. The laminar container has a circular base having a double concentric cone. The laminar container's sides close on itself to create a self-bearing square, or geometric, outline container with lids. The container is manually formed from the an engraved laminar sheet. The containers can be stored and transported flat.

Grass-Containing Liquid Packaging Board
20220290374 · 2022-09-15 ·

The method according to the invention for producing a grass fibre-containing liquid packaging board has the following steps, specifically: providing a fibre suspension formed from at least a first and second pulp type, wherein the first pulp type is constituted by grass fibres, and the second pulp type is selected from a group of pulps which comprises primary fibres such as chemical pulp, for example sulphate pulp or sulphite pulp, in each case based on long-fibre wood or short-fibre wood, wood pulp, and synthetic fibres or recycled fibres based on one or more recycled paper classifications, mixing and/or swelling the fibres in the pulp suspension under predefined conditions with respect to material density and temperature, grinding the at least two pulp types together in a pulp suspension to a degree of dewatering between 40° SR and 60° SR, adding starch and/or a sizing agent as an additive in the mass, diluting the pulp suspension and producing a board on a paper machine, surface sizing the board using at least one starch-containing suspension, and drying the paper structure to a dry content between 4% and 10%.

Container for liquids
11439964 · 2022-09-13 · ·

A container for liquids has a top, a bottom and a mid-section. A plurality of side panels forming the mid-section, and a plurality of top panels enclose the top of the container. One of the top panels has an openable seal for removing liquid from the container when the seal is broken. A plurality of bottom flaps are provided for closing the bottom of the container, and a baffle is secured inside of the container. The baffle has at least one opening for mixing liquid contained in the container when the container is closed and shaken.

PACKAGING FOR THE COOLED STORAGE OF AT LEAST ONE PRODUCT AND ASSOCIATED CONTAINER
20220112021 · 2022-04-14 ·

The invention relates to packaging (10) for the cooled storage of at least one product (12), with (a) an outer casing (14) that comprises (i) a base (22) and (ii) at least three walls (24), (b) an inner compartment (16) for accommodating the product (12) and (c) a coolant compartment (18) that (i) surrounds the inner compartment (16) on at least three sides and (ii) is water-tight, wherein (d) the outer casing (14) surrounds the coolant compartment (18) and wherein (e) the outer casing (14) and the inner compartment (16) are designed in such a way that the coolant compartment (18) is watertight and can be filled with water such that, after the water freezes, the water cools the products (12) in the inner compartment (16).
